Hey y’all! I’m excited to finally share something I’ve been working on for a while. This project was a huge help when I was first learning about craft beer & studying for my Certified Cicerone. I initially just wanted the BJCP Style Guidelines on one sheet for each style. But as I typed them up and took notes, I realized it was a perfect way to study at the same time.

I’m hoping this will be useful for folks working on their BJCP or Cicerone certifications. I’ll be sharing a new style each week or so. If there’s one you’d like to see or want sent your way, just let me know!

I started this 8 years ago with the 2015 Guidelines but recently picked it back up. Now that I have more time, & am free to chase my whims & curiosities, I decided to dive into programming with Python & VBA (I knew that college class would come in handy). I transcribed all the BJCP style parameters into an Excel sheet & wrote a macro to create a map in Visio for each style.

Starting with American Light Lager was a no-brainer. It’s the first style in the guidelines & the one I have the most experience with by far.
